Output c22fb3642f61e0d436b750b562db69071e774d68f163a0919c1f6aae79df365a:0

value
24668720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0e96ae32b40ddba7087cfae4f8ff48cf1538cb OP_EQUAL
address
34Rwfw1gsSAoLcHUASfAztotm8xxct1hTt
transaction
c22fb3642f61e0d436b750b562db69071e774d68f163a0919c1f6aae79df365a
spent
true